An investigator is interested in studying teacher management behavior. He located two groups of teachers previously identified as either competent in teacher management behavior or incompetent in teacher management behavior. He found that the competent teachers' students were significantly more engaged in learning than were incompetent teachers' students. What conclusion should the investigator
draw from this finding?
a. Competent teacher management behavior causes students to be more engaged in learning.
b. Competent teacher management behavior and student engagement in learning occur together.
c. To ensure that students become engaged in learning, teachers should become competent in classroom management behavior.
B
